Journey along the California coastline from Los Angeles to San Francisco on this 5-day group tour, visiting Santa Barbara, Carmel and more. Enjoy a San Francisco Bay cruise, see Alcatraz and spend a night at Stevenson Ranch. If travelling in summer, take a hike to a waterfall in Yosemite National Park, whilst winter departures explore the historic city of Monterey. See the highlights of the Las Vegas strip, enjoy a free night on the town and visit Hoover Dam on your way back to Los Angeles.
Journey from Los Angeles to Las Vegas on this 8-day group tour of the American west. Head along the California coast, visiting Santa Barbara, Carmel and San Francisco, home to the Golden Gate Bridge. In summer, enjoy a hike in Yosemite National Park, or explore Monterey during winter. Tour the magical Las Vegas Strip, see the engineering marvel that is the Hoover Dam and soak up the dramatic landscapes of Sedona. Explore Monument Valley, see the well-photographed Horseshoe Bend and visit Antelope Canyon before returning to Vegas.
From Los Angeles, enjoy a day of guided sightseeing in San Francisco, including a Bay cruise and the Golden Gate Bridge. Visit the Spanish Mission in Santa Barbara, explore the 'Danish capital' of America in Solvang and stop in Carmel, the town of Clint Eastwood. On summer departures, hike to a majestic waterfall in Yosemite National Park, whilst on winter tours enjoy a morning of sightseeing in coastal Monterey, before returning to LA.
From soaring redwoods to cultural meccas and verdant valleys, explore the rich sights, sounds, and tastes of California. Wander through a forest of some of the world’s largest trees at Sequoia and Kings Canyon National Parks. Dive into history in San Diego and into the glitz and glamour of Los Angeles. Discover a centuries-old mission in Santa Barbara and go on a walking food tour in the charming coastal town of Carlsbad. Savor a glass of locally produced wine and lunch at a Paso Robles vineyard.
